Поделиться через


IVsFormatFilterProvider - интерфейс

Интерфейс, чтобы предоставить расширение файла для проверки Сохранить как функциональные возможности.

Пространство имен:  Microsoft.VisualStudio.TextManager.Interop
Сборка:  Microsoft.VisualStudio.TextManager.Interop (в Microsoft.VisualStudio.TextManager.Interop.dll)

Синтаксис

'Декларация
<InterfaceTypeAttribute()> _
<GuidAttribute("181237A7-4861-4D6C-8CA1-8A004BEA2E8E")> _
Public Interface IVsFormatFilterProvider
[InterfaceTypeAttribute()]
[GuidAttribute("181237A7-4861-4D6C-8CA1-8A004BEA2E8E")]
public interface IVsFormatFilterProvider
[InterfaceTypeAttribute()]
[GuidAttribute(L"181237A7-4861-4D6C-8CA1-8A004BEA2E8E")]
public interface class IVsFormatFilterProvider
[<InterfaceTypeAttribute()>]
[<GuidAttribute("181237A7-4861-4D6C-8CA1-8A004BEA2E8E")>]
type IVsFormatFilterProvider =  interface end
public interface IVsFormatFilterProvider

Тип IVsFormatFilterProvider предоставляет следующие члены.

Методы

  Имя Описание
Открытый метод CurFileExtensionFormat Предоставляет индекс в списке фильтра соответствует расширению файла, переданного.
Открытый метод GetFormatFilterList Предоставляет список доступных расширений для Сохранить как диалоговое окно.
Открытый метод QueryInvalidEncoding Предоставляет отчеты пользователь выбрал сообщение, что он является кодирование, не поддерживается службой языка.

В начало страницы

Заметки

Примечания для разработчиков

Реализуется службами языка, которым необходимо убедиться, что расширение файла, указанные пользователем обрабатывается службой языка.

См. также

Ссылки

Microsoft.VisualStudio.TextManager.Interop - пространство имен